From: Kay Sievers Date: Sun, 8 Dec 2013 05:36:39 +0000 (+0100) Subject: test: cgroup-util - do not fail if cpu controller is not available X-Git-Tag: v209~1095 X-Git-Url: https://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=commitdiff_plain;h=e13bb5d2b133f9ae51c0a2d20aa51071c780e9ae test: cgroup-util - do not fail if cpu controller is not available --- diff --git a/src/test/test-cgroup-util.c b/src/test/test-cgroup-util.c index 16bf96834..4d802d483 100644 --- a/src/test/test-cgroup-util.c +++ b/src/test/test-cgroup-util.c @@ -193,8 +193,9 @@ static void test_escape(void) { test_escape_one(".foobar", "_.foobar"); test_escape_one("foobar.service", "foobar.service"); test_escape_one("cgroup.service", "_cgroup.service"); - test_escape_one("cpu.service", "_cpu.service"); test_escape_one("tasks", "_tasks"); + if (access("/sys/fs/cgroup/cpu", F_OK) == 0) + test_escape_one("cpu.service", "_cpu.service"); test_escape_one("_foobar", "__foobar"); test_escape_one("", "_"); test_escape_one("_", "__");